Output 8253fa82befb6b587bf7e297e68a36f42b115b189e4ecc70a55a68594679b800:0

value
2560818
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9702764d63eebbf5234305b4d6f9948a5c5139ec OP_EQUALVERIFY OP_CHECKSIG
address
1EmTz3Ajqf7RfAZsrotq8uyqFDworYCe4A
transaction
8253fa82befb6b587bf7e297e68a36f42b115b189e4ecc70a55a68594679b800
spent
true